Serious injury for Benjamin Sesko
Manchester United manager Ruben Amorim expressed concerns about a serious knee injury to striker Benjamin Sesko. This may prompt the club to look for new players in the transfer market in January.Sesko, 22, came on as a substitute in the 58th minute of the match where Manchester United drew 2:2 with Tottenham. However, he was forced to leave the field in the 88th minute due to a questionable tackle from Mikey van de Beek.“I am very upset as he may have a serious injury,” noted Amorim.Injury issues may prompt the club to intensify the search for new forwards in January. The situation with Benjamin Sesko has become yet another signal for Manchester United, which is trying to remain competitive this season.
